Warrior (2011) "Warrior" is a 2011 American sports drama film directed by Gavin O’Connor, starring Tom Hardy, Joel Edgerton, and Nick Nolte. The movie follows two estranged brothers, Tommy and Brendan Conlon, who enter a high-stakes mixed martial arts tournament called Sparta. Tommy, a former Marine, seeks to win the $5 million prize to support the family of a fallen comrade, while Brendan, a high school teacher, fights to save his home and provide for his family. Their journey intersects as they confront their troubled past and family dynamics. The film is notable for its raw and emotionally charged performances, as well as its realistic and intense fight choreography. Themes of redemption, forgiveness, and family reconciliation are central to the narrative. The movie's climax features a dramatic fight between the brothers, culminating in a poignant moment of reconciliation. With its blend of action and heartfelt drama, "Warrior" offers a compelling exploration of human struggle and the complexities of familial relationships. The film received critical acclaim for its performances and storytelling, earning several awards and nominations.
